Turks Accuse Israel of War Crimes at Int'l Court

Turkish lawyers representing pro-Palestinian activists have complained to the International Criminal Court that Israeli troops committed war crimes when they raided a boat trying to break Israel's blockade of Gaza in May.

Nine Turkish citizens, including a 19-year-old with dual U.S.-Turkish nationality, were killed during the melee after Israeli troops rappelled from helicopters onto the deck of the Mavi Marmara.

Israel said its troops fired live ammunition only when their lives were threatened.

Attorney Ugur Sevgili said Thursday victims want Israel investigated for torture, inhuman treatment and violations of the Geneva war crimes convention.

The international court receives hundreds of applications every year but opens investigations in few cases.
